What a good bricklaying quote includes

A good quote spells out how the job is priced and what's covered — labour, materials, prep and clean-up — so you're comparing like for like. Check what each bricklayer's quote covers before you choose.

Worth knowing: getting two or three quotes is the simplest way to land a fair price — and it costs you nothing.

  • Brick specs. Exact brand, type and colour so you compare like with like.

  • Footings and piers. Depth, width, concrete grade and pier spacing, all named.

  • Mortar mix. Lime or cement and the ratio, important for older homes.

  • Brickwork scope. Wall type, dimensions, height and bond pattern.

  • Scaffolding and clean-up. Whether scaffold, skip and waste removal are included.

  • Licence and ABN. Both on the quote so you can verify them.

How much do bricklayers typically charge?
Costs for bricklaying vary depending on the job—simple repairs are typically much less than building new walls that need footings or excavation. Many bricklayers charge a call-out fee plus an hourly labour rate, and after-hours or specialist heritage work is often charged at higher rates. Do bricklayers charge call-out fees?
Call-out fees are common for bricklayers, particularly for small or single-visit jobs. This fee is usually separate from labour and materials costs. It's worth asking each tradesperson whether a call-out or minimum charge applies to your job.

Can bricklayer work be done in summer in Gillen?
It's difficult — Gillen regularly exceeds 35°C for extended periods. Materials applied in extreme heat dry too fast and won't cure properly. Schedule for the cooler months where possible, or plan for very early morning application windows.
Can concrete be poured in winter in Gillen?
Gillen gets regular frost, and freeze-thaw cycling can compromise concrete and mortar if applied in cold conditions. Most tradies here will schedule pours for the warmer months and use frost-rated mixes when winter work is unavoidable.
